How to fill out form 990

How to fill out form 990
01
Gather all necessary organization information, including its name, address, and Employer Identification Number (EIN).
02
Read the instructions for Form 990 carefully to understand each section.
03
Complete the first part of the form, which includes basic organizational information.
04
Fill out the financial data section, including revenue, expenses, and net assets.
05
Provide details on the organization's programs and activities in the appropriate sections.
06
Include a list of the board of directors and key employees.
07
Attach any required schedules that pertain to the organization's specific activities (e.g. Schedule A for public charities).
08
Review the form for accuracy and completeness.
09
Sign and date the form before submission.
10
File the form electronically or by mail to the appropriate IRS address.
Who needs form 990?
01
Tax-exempt organizations that meet the IRS filing requirements, including charities and non-profit organizations.
02
Organizations with gross receipts over a certain threshold, which typically is $200,000.
03
Organizations with total assets over $500,000.
04
Private foundations must file Form 990-PF instead of Form 990 but are still part of the same reporting requirements.

What is form 990?
Form 990 is an annual reporting return that certain tax-exempt organizations must file with the IRS. It provides an overview of the organization's activities, governance, and detailed financial information.
Who is required to file form 990?
Organizations that are recognized as tax-exempt under section 501(c)(3) and other sections of the Internal Revenue Code, with gross receipts over $200,000 or total assets over $500,000, generally must file Form 990.
How to fill out form 990?
To fill out Form 990, organizations should gather financial statements, details about governance and management, program service accomplishments, and donative support information. They can then complete the form based on the IRS instructions and submit it electronically or by mail.
What is the purpose of form 990?
The purpose of Form 990 is to provide transparency and accountability for tax-exempt organizations, ensuring compliance with tax laws and giving information to the IRS and the public about the financial health and operations of the organization.
What information must be reported on form 990?
Form 990 requires reporting of the organization's mission, revenue, expenses, net assets, executive compensation, contributions, and a detailed account of programs and services provided.
